Detailed explanation-1: -A physical boundary is a naturally occurring barrier between two areas. Rivers, mountain ranges, oceans, and deserts can all serve as physical boundaries. Many times, political boundaries between countries or states form along physical boundaries.

Detailed explanation-2: -In geography, boundaries separate different regions of Earth. A physical boundary is a naturally occurring barrier between two or more areas. Physical boundaries include oceans, cliffs, or valleys.

Detailed explanation-3: -Answer and Explanation: The Ural Mountains are considered a natural boundary because they separate the continents of Europe and Asia. Europe lies to the west, and Asia to the east.

Detailed explanation-4: -Some examples of mountain ranges as boundaries include the Zagros Mountains between Iraq and Iran, the Pyrenees between Spain and France, and the Andes Mountains between Chile and Argentina. In contrast to physical boundaries, geometric boundaries and ethnic boundaries are not related to natural features.
